Title

A Review study on PESTICIDE-INDUCED effects IN FRESHWATER FISH.

Abstract

Pesticides can be defined as chemical substances which are used to kill, control or repel pests. Chlorinated hydrocarbons are fat-soluble and are trooped into the body. Man is at the top of the food chain/food Web and consumes plants as well as animals and carries small amounts of pesticides and ultimately increases to the danger level. This is called bio-magnification which causes the severe physiological disorder. Toxic effects can be sensed immediately after exposure to a toxicant or when followed by a lag. These effects are determined by the toxicological characteristics of the substance and the ability of the organisms to metabolize it. Histopathology is the study of the structure of diseased or injured cells or a study of pathological change in the microanatomy of tissues is known as histopathology. Fish constitutes a valuable commodity from the standpoint of human consumption. Aquatic pollution undoubtedly has direct effects on fish health, reproduction, and survival. Pesticides are regarded as serious pollutants of the aquatic environment because of their environmental persistence and tendency to be concentrated in aquatic organisms. A change in biochemical constituents in fish gives an indication, helping to understand the type of pollutants and their mode of action. Despite the facts, like other living organisms, fish also has its detoxification mechanism to encounter the toxic effects; however, if the toxic substance enters the body, certainly damages and weaken the mechanism concerned. The damage may be at a cellular or molecular level, but ultimately it will lead to physiological, pathological, and biochemical changes.
